Celeste Developers Announce New Game Earthblade

Celeste was an absolute achievement in video game design, perfectly blending an emotional narrative with its hard-as-nails gameplay. It was never frustrating, but rather a constant testament to your own strengths. Developer Extremely OK Games knocked it out of the park, so the announcement of their new game Earthblade has us very excited.

Coming in 20XX, as cited by the team, it's described as "2D explor-action game in a seamless pixel art world". Little else is known outside of the title reveal, but a sound clip gives a taste of the ambiance through its stellar musical score.

Further details can be found in a blog post from the developer, although it seems like the game is way, way off. They confirmed it will "probably be a while" before more information on the game is released, but the team seems excited to share its existence, and we can't blame them.

"I am so excited about this project. I can see the whole thing in my head. Not perfectly, mind you — most of the details are still pretty blurry in my mental image, and I'm sure a lot will change along the way. But I can see the general shape of it, and I feel really good about where it's going. Now it's our job to turn this ephemeral, pristine mind-object into a real, imperfect & human actual-object. We'll be here, slowly grinding away at that task every day. We really hope that at the end of this, some of you will enjoy what we make."

Instead of sharing images along the development track as they did with Celeste, the team has decided to opt for a "big reveal that will hopefully blow your socks off". As for now, the aim is to get the "general vibe", and that feeling we're getting is cosy Secret of Mana and EarthBound vibes.

While it may be a way off for now, we're excited to know another project is in the works. Whether it will meet the dizzying heights of Celeste remains to be seen, but we have faith Extremely OK Games can create something special.
